Posted in

Go map key比较的隐藏开销:interface{}比较为何比int慢17倍?源码直击runtime.efaceeq实现细节

第一章:Go map key比较 … Go map key比较的隐藏开销:interface{}比较为何比int慢17倍?源码直击runtime.efaceeq实现细节Read more

Posted in

Go map底层key比较逻辑:==运算符如何被编译为memequal或专用汇编?nil interface{}与空struct的哈希路径差异

第一章:Go map哈希底层用的 … Go map底层key比较逻辑:==运算符如何被编译为memequal或专用汇编?nil interface{}与空struct的哈希路径差异Read more